Also because APR software is undetectable to a dealers VAG diagnostic tool, thus it will not void the warranty!

 

Don't be so sure. I had and APR 2 stage program....stock and 93 octane programs in my car, as well as vallet program. All interchangeable from the cruise control stock, and when I blew my turbos in my allroad, they found that the map had changed, so they did not cover the replacement under warranty. It cost me nearly $4800usd to fix.

 

So, even GIAC and their DiPP is detectable. There is no secure method to chip any of the VAG cars. With their OBD2 scanners, they can detect map changes. What you want to do is get a spare ecu and chip that. But also remember, there is now a chastity belt on the ecu housing, so if you open that, that also will void some warranty.

 

With the DiPP, you are safe for routine service and simple warranty issues, but if there is a turbo issue, Audi has recently come out with a statement and they will actively search for chipped ecus or changed maps.

 

Just be careful before you actually do that modification. The dealers are not as dumb as everyone thinks. Audi or VW will call in the regional manager when they have reason to believe that the cars ecu has been modified, as the regional manager is the only one allowed to physically look at the ecu for modification. Not sure the reasoning behind that, but that was what i was told when my car went under the knife.
